What is a Lithium Battery Valve? A lithium battery valve is a safety device designed to regulate the internal pressure and prevent excessive build-up of gas inside a battery. When a battery is charged or discharged, chemical reactions take place, which can sometimes generate heat and gases. In the event of a fault or overcharge, these gases can lead to an increase in internal pressure. The lithium battery valve serves as a safety mechanism by allowing the safe release of gases when pressure exceeds a certain threshold, thus preventing damage, leakage, or even explosions. The valve is often integrated into the battery’s design and works automatically without the need for external intervention.
